 Yulia  Samoylova


Born:   April 7, 1989

Modern Russian singer

      

Yulia Samoylova will represent Russia at the EuroVision 2017 song contest in Kiev, Ukraine. She will sing the song "Flame Is Burning".
Yulia Samoylova was born in the city of Ukhta in the Komi Republic of the Russian Federation. At the age of 13, after an inept poliomyelitis vaccination the girl found herself handicapped. Since then Yulia Samoylova has been wheelchair-bound.
After the 5th grade at comprehensive school the girl shifted to home schooling. Afterwards Yulia entered Ukhta branch of the Modern Humanitarian Academy to major in psychology but did not graduate.
Yulia has been into music since early school. At the age of 10 she performed at a charity concert for the first time. This is when the young singer was noticed and invited to the local Palace of Pioneers, where she studied vocal under teacher Svetlana Shirokova.
Yulia Samoylova has already participated in a number of regional and All-Russian musical competitions. The victory at the All-Russian festival "On the Wings of Dream", which took place in Moscow in 2003 became one of the most remarkable achievements in her children's music career.
In 2008 Yulia Samoylova founded a rock band under the name of TerraNova. However it lasted for two years only before breaking up. After that the singer moved to St. Petersburg and applied to the Public Relations Department of St. Petersburg State University but was not a success. Having returned to Ukhta, she opened an advertizing agency. In 2012-2013 Yulia Samoylova participated in the New Ukhta competition and won the Grand Prix.
The girl gained the all-Russian fame after taking part in the Factor A project on the TV channel Russia 1 in 2013. Yulia Samoylova took the 2nd prize at the contest and Alla's Gold Star award from Alla Pugacheva.
In November, 2013 she won Elena Mukhina National Award in the nomination "Unbroken Note" (the award was founded by the Russian Paralympic Committee). In 2014 Yulia Samoylova participated in the opening ceremony of  of the Winter Paralympic Games in Sochi and sang the song "Together".
She was among 27 performers who participated in recording of Igor Matviyenko' song "Live" dedicated to the air crash Liner A321 over the Sinai Peninsula in 2016.
Yulia Samoylova has recorded several songs of her own, including "Light", as well as A New Day with lyrics by Konstantin Arsenev and music by Alexander Yakovlev.
